Charles David Stone1

b. 30 October 1864, d. 24 June 1940
Birth30 Oct 1864 Charles David Stone was born on 30 Oct 1864.1 
Marriage26 Dec 1889 He married Lillie Anna Ryburn, daughter of Samuel Washington Ryburn and Stacy Maria Crumley, on 26 Dec 1889 in Sullivan County, Tennessee.2 
Cens-Sum Lillie and Charles appear to have spent the first years of their married life in the 22nd District of Sullivan County. The 1910 census specifically listed them on Lowry Rd. There they raised 4 children: Carl, Ruth, Oscar and Albert.3,4,5 
Cens-19308 Apr 1930 By 1930, however they were enumerated in the 2nd Civil District, living next to Lillie's widowed father. The census data clarified that they were still farming and that they owned their home, but they did not own a radio (one of the questions unique to the 1930 census). Oscar and Ruth were single andl living at home. Oscar worked as a clerk in a hotel and Ruth was employed as a school teacher.6 
Death24 Jun 1940 Charles died on 24 Jun 1940 at age 75.1 
Burial He was buried at Cold Springs Cemetery in Sullivan County, Tennesee.1
